At Senshi Karate Club, I keep things lively and easygoing for the youngest karate beginners, even the tiny tots starting at age 3. There’s loads of playful energy – sometimes the kids are all jumping around, sometimes just sprawled out together after a round of fun karate games.
I blend basic stances, punches, and learning about karate belts with games and stories, so children get the feel of martial arts without pressure. Drawing sessions and group games are part of our daily routine. Watching the kids make new friends and laugh together is honestly the highlight.
We use different spaces, sometimes indoors and other times outdoors on the lawn, so kids get fresh air and a change of scene. If you’re looking for outdoor karate camp for young kids, this is it – we love switching it up.
Don’t stress about gear – some kids come in gis, others just in shorts and tees. Comfort is key, especially for beginner karate for preschoolers.
I’m not a strict sensei here. My job is more like a guide, cheering every win and making sure every kid feels safe, happy, and confident. The camp is about learning, but it’s also about building a karate confidence for toddlers and having a good time.
